Issues for Renminbi Internationalization: An Overview [PDF]

open access: yesSSRN Electronic Journal, 2014
This paper provides an overview of the potential international role of the renminbi (RMB). Reviewing the current state, the paper finds that much progress has been made on RMB settlements for trade involving the People’s Republic of China (PRC) and on RMB-denominated bond issuance in Hong Kong, China, but that RMB internationalization is still limited ...

Renminbi Misaligned - Results from Meta-Regressions [PDF]

open access: yesSSRN Electronic Journal, 2009
We collect data from 29 separate papers estimating the equilibrium level and possible undervaluation of the Chinese currency, the renminbi. These papers yield a total of 97 individual observations on misalignment, which we analyse with the help of meta-analysis.
